Sidewalk Pavers Installation in Boston, MA
Sidewalk pavers installation involves placing durable, attractive paving materials to create safe and accessible walkways around residential properties. This service typically covers projects such as front and backyard walkways, pathways connecting driveways to entrances, and decorative accents for patios or garden areas. Property owners often want to understand the different types of pavers available, including materials like concrete, brick, or stone, as well as the overall process involved in preparing the ground, laying the pavers, and ensuring proper drainage and stability for long-lasting results.
Before requesting sidewalk pavers installation, homeowners usually consider factors such as the desired design, the size and shape of the area to be paved, and the level of foot traffic the walkway will endure. It’s also important to understand the maintenance requirements of different paver materials and how the installation will complement the existing landscape and exterior features. Clarifying these details helps ensure the project aligns with aesthetic preferences and functional needs, resulting in a durable and visually appealing walkway.

Sidewalk Pavers Installation Questions
What types of surfaces are suitable for sidewalk pavers? Sidewalk pavers work well on concrete, gravel, and existing paved surfaces, providing a durable and attractive walkway option.
Are sidewalk pavers a good choice for uneven ground? Yes, pavers can be installed on uneven surfaces with proper preparation to create a stable and level walkway.
How long does a typical sidewalk paver installation take? Installation times vary depending on the project size, but most installations are completed within a few days.
What are common patterns for sidewalk pavers? Popular patterns include herringbone, basket weave, and running bond, which add visual interest to walkways.
